> I'm not 
> getting this event at all. Does the irq need to be enabled somehow? What 
> does enable_irq_wake() do? Is that to allow a particular irq to wake up 
> the processor when is suspend or does it mean the irq is make active?

enable_irq_wake() marks that particular IRQ as one that can wake the 
processor from suspend.  AFAIK it assumes that the IRQ is otherwise 
functional.
